I was just looking through the latest from the Readings Panel at GreatVessel.com . The questioner asked how to deal with a difficult manager, and received Hexagram 10, Treading, moving to Hexagram 61, Inner Truth, through a changing line at the fourth place:
‘Treading the tiger’s tail.
Careful pleading,
Good fortune in the end.’

I store my I Ching readings on my computer; I have done for many years. It makes them easier to review, both because my handwriting’s in the ‘inebriated spider meanderings’ class, and because of the wonders of search.

Consistently the most popular topic for questions to the I Ching is romantic relationships. Blend equal quantities of passionate desire, wild hope and utter bafflement, and you get questions for an oracle - lots of questions.
